The International Association of Mathematical Physics (IAMP) was founded in
1976 in order to promote research in mathematical physics. The Association
invites mathematicians and physicists (including students) interested in
this goal to become members.
The Association sponsors a Congress every three years (in 1994 the meeting
was held at UNESCO in Paris, and in 1997 was held at the University
in Brisbane). The Association also publishes this Web site, as well as a news
bulletin sent to members three times each year. The bulletin includes
advertisements of positions in mathematical physics as well as announcements
of other news and activities of the Association.
Membership supports the activities of the Association. One special
advantage of membership is steep discounts on personal subscriptions to
several journals and on certain books. These include Communications
in Mathematical Physics and Letters in Mathematical Physics.
Applications for ordinary membership may be made on the Web.
Dues are quite modest (now $20/year for ordinary members, payable in
different currencies as well as by credit card). Present students
engaged in research in mathematics or in physics, and sponsored by two
current members, will be inscribed for their first year as ordinary members
without fee.

Past Presidents:
Walter Thirring 1976-78
Huzihiro Araki 1979-81
Elliott Lieb 1982-84
Konrad Osterwalder 1985-87
John Klauder 1988-90
Arthur Jaffe 1991-96
Elliott
Lieb 1997-99
Herbert
Spohn 2000-2002
David Brydges 2003-2005
